Iraola starts Liverpool reign with 4-2 comeback victory over Sunderland

Andoni Iraola enjoyed a winning start as Liverpool manager after the Reds came from behind to defeat Sunderland 4-2 in their opening pre-season tour match in the United States.

Andoni Iraola began his Liverpool tenure with a 4-2 victory over Sunderland in Nashville as the Reds kicked off their pre-season tour of the United States in style.

Kieran Morrison opened the scoring before Sunderland turned the game around, only for Dominik Szoboszlai, Federico Chiesa and Lewis Koumas to complete Liverpool’s comeback.

Joe Gomez, however, suffered an early injury and was substituted with a suspected muscle problem.

According to Sky Sports, Iraola admitted there were areas to improve but described the performance as a positive starting point, while confirming Gomez’s injury was the biggest concern from the match. Source: Sky Sports.
